### Changed defaults in extract-strings v4.2

Heads up: the LinguaReap extraction script now skips vendored directories by default and writes output in sorted order, so diffs should be way smaller. If a deploy suddenly drops a bunch of strings, that's probably why — check the new ignore list before panicking. The defaults the script now ships with are as follows.

config for kafof-bawef:
holath:
  log_level: debug
  metrics_host: metrics.holath.qorvelsys.internal
  pin: 2191
  pool_size: 32

## Deployment

The Larkspur gateway enforces per-client rate limits at the edge before requests reach internal services. Limits are token-bucket based and tuned per route class. Deploys pick up changes on restart only, so coordinate with the on-call rotation. The current production limits are as follows.

service settings:
PRAIX_LOG_LEVEL=error
PRAIX_METRICS_HOST=metrics.praix.qorvelcorp.corp
PRAIX_POOL_SIZE=16

**Finance Review Summary — Headcount Plan**

Next year's plan for Torvalight assumes 212 heads, up nine, concentrated in the Ansdell engineering group. Salary inflation is modelled at 4.2%, with attrition held at 11%. Contractor spend falls as roles convert. Flag any variances early in the cycle. The following note provides essential context.

confidential, kagup-bafog: Fraaxax Group is in early talks to buy Soroxox Group for about $343.8 million. The Olidor launch date is June 14, and nothing goes to the press before then. Legal wants the Aldmirek Logistics term sheet signed before July 23.